Best Schools in 06375, CT
06375, CT has a total of 8 schools including 3 high schools, 2 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 3,095 students attend 06375, CT schools. On average, schools in 06375 score 33%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 36%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in 06375 don't meet expectations.

Community Factors
06375, CT has a total population of 3,735 with 20%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 95%, and 37%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
